Machine Learning Engineer, Digital Experience
Job Description
You will join the Machine Learning Engineer role on the Digital Experience Insights team at Everpure, helping advance machine learning work from early prototypes into dependable production systems. The focus of this position is building the pipelines, infrastructure, and engineering practices that keep models reliable over time.
Role Summary
As a Machine Learning Engineer, you will take machine learning models from prototype to production by building pipelines, infrastructure, and engineering practices. When needed, you will also build and validate models, with an emphasis on ensuring models make it into production and remain healthy after deployment.
Responsibilities
- Move machine learning models from prototype to production by building reliable, scalable pipelines for training, serving, and inference.
- Design and maintain data pipelines, feature stores, and workflow orchestration to ensure models receive clean, timely, and well-tested inputs.
- Implement monitoring for model performance, data drift, and pipeline health, and take action when issues arise.
- Build and validate machine learning models and statistical approaches as needed, partnering with the broader data science team on model design.
- Collaborate with Data Scientists, Data Engineers, and Software Engineers to translate open-ended business questions into a clear technical plan and a functioning production system.
- Work primarily from the Santa Clara office (onsite) in accordance with Everpure policies, unless on PTO, work travel, or other approved leave.
Requirements
- Bachelor’s, Master’s, or Ph.D. in Computer Science, Data Science, Engineering, Statistics, or a related field, or equivalent practical experience.
- 3 to 5 years of industry experience in data engineering, ML engineering, or a hybrid data science/engineering role, with a track record of shipping models to production.
- Strong software engineering fundamentals in Python and SQL, including the ability to write production-quality, well-tested code.
- Hands-on experience with a workflow orchestration tool such as Airflow or Dagster.
- Experience working in a cloud-native environment such as AWS, GCP, or Azure.
- Working knowledge of machine learning and statistical modeling, with familiarity in libraries such as Scikit-Learn or PyTorch, and enough grounding to build or extend models when needed.
- Good communication skills, including the ability to explain technical work clearly to non-technical stakeholders.
- Comfort operating through ambiguity and shifting priorities, with a collaborative approach across teams.
